Wearing a face mask, Brazil's President Jair Bolsonaro posed for photographs with kids plucked out of a crowd of supporters, disregarding public health advice aimed at containing one of the world's worst coronavirus outbreaks, according to Reuters.
In an online video, Bolsonaro said he welcomed the demonstration at the presidential palace in what has become a nearly biweekly affair, with the president and supporters defying quarantines that have the support of most Brazilians.
“Above all [the people] want freedom, they want democracy, they want respect,” he said, adding that Brazilians want to get the economy back up and running as quickly as possible.
